The cost of water heater service depends mainly on the type of unit, the nature of the problem, and how easily the equipment can be accessed. A minor repair stays modest; a full swap costs more once the permit and the removal of the old unit are counted. Since July 1, 2026, Public Health – Seattle & King County has required a plumbing permit for replacement water heaters; most qualify for an over-the-counter permit, while related electrical or gas work may require additional permits.

The cost of installing a water heater reflects its size, the fuel it runs on, and how much of the old setup has to change. Converting to a tankless system or installing a larger tank generally falls at the higher end of the price range.
